COVID-19: Proof of vaccine now needed to fly in Canada

As of Tuesday, travellers over the age of 12 who aren’t vaccinated against COVID-19 won’t be able to board a plane or passenger train in Canada.

However, there are a few exceptions. As Kim Smith reports, there was at least one passenger at Edmonton International Airport denied boarding on Day 1. .
